Chia seeds get a lot of hype in the blood sugar world. You might see them added to puddings, smoothies, or water and hear that they can magically prevent glucose spikes. So what is actually true? Today we’re breaking down what chia seeds do in the body, how they may support blood sugar, and where expectations can get a little unrealistic.If you're living with diabetes or prediabetes and want personalized support from a Registered Dietitian Nutritionist covered by insurance, visit diabetesdigital.co to connect with our culturally aware and weight-inclusive team.
